SENAVEN, officially known as the National Service for Agricultural and Livestock Health, is a government institution dedicated to protecting and regulating agricultural production. Its primary mission in 2026 is to safeguard plant and animal health, ensure food safety, and prevent the spread of pests, diseases, and contaminants that could threaten public health and the economy.
